Keiko O'Brien kept Idran hybrids aboard Deep Space 9 in 2373. In that year, Julian Bashir inadvertently added too much water, killing them. Miles O'Brien replaced them with Bajoran spiny basil. (DS9: "The Assignment") Idran hybrids seem to be named after the Idran system, a star system (without Class M planets) in the Gamma Quadrant According to the script, Idran was pronounced as "IH-drahn".
